Title: Scheduler double-waters bed 3 after DST shift

New folks: the Verdella scheduler stores watering slots in local time. After the clock change, slot 06:00 fires twice, soaking the herb bed. Fix: store UTC, convert at display. Repro on the Oakhollow test rig only. To reproduce, install the firmware identified by the token below.

build token for hafop-kahog: htk31_a432ac515d5bb1362002c1e1a7e80ef

## Training Studio Access — Room 4.02

The Brightvale studio on level 4 is for recording training videos only. Book via the facilities calendar; max two-hour slots. Red light on means recording — do not enter. Leave mics on chargers, lights off, door shut. No food inside. Facilities desk grants access using the door code below.

staff pass of kawip-hawef = bdg-QLP-2

### Account Recovery — Marrowtide Diff Viewer

When a customer is locked out mid-review of a large-file diff, their session state in the Marrowtide viewer is preserved for 72 hours. Verify identity per the standard script, then restore the session rather than resetting it, since re-rendering diffs over 500 MB can take several minutes. To unlock the session-restore console, enter the recovery passphrase shown below.

recovery phrase for kajop-yagef: istael-ulaius

Subject: Handover — WikiVault RBAC duties

Hi Dorran,

Taking over from me on WikiVault role-based access. Quick notes: roles live in the auth schema, group mappings sync nightly from Fennick Directory. Don't edit the editors table by hand — use the grants script in ops/rbac. Audit log rotates weekly; keep 90 days. Pending items: stale contractor roles need pruning, and the viewer role leaks draft pages. For the grants script and audit queries, connect to the RBAC database with this:

Best,
Maelis

replica DSN, yahaf-yagaf: mongodb://tamath_svc:a2netSk3RZMuTj@db-d084.novacsoft.internal:5432/ralmir